After Christmas was over, I decided to go ahead and get myself another gift: a Vitamix!  I've been wanting one of these babies for quite some time now, and I finally pulled the trigger.  I couldn't be happier with my decision.  I think I am actually in love with an inanimate object.  This delicious roasted asparagus soup was my first vitamix recipe, and it was great.  In retrospect, I would probably leave a few spares of asparagus out of the blender, cut them up, and then stir them into the blended soup at the end, just to give it a little more texture.

What you need:
  • 2 lbs. Asparagus
  • 1/2 lemon, juiced
  • 1 tbsp minced garlic
  • 1/2 onion, chopped
  • 1 tbsp cashew butter
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• 2 cups vegetable broth
  • Salt, to taste

First, preheat your oven to 450 degrees.  Grease a pan and lay out all of your asparagus spears.  Once the oven heats up, throw the asparagus in for about 8 minutes.  Take the tray out, rotate your spears, and add onion and garlic to the baking tray.  Roast for another 6 minutes or until everything looks sufficiently roasted.



While everything is roasting, put the broth and cashew butter into the blender. When your veggies are done, toss those in the blender, too.  If your blender has a hot soup setting, you can use that, otherwise blend for about 8 minutes on high to make it hot.  If you don't have a vitamix or blendtec, worry not.  Just blend everything together, transfer to a sauce pan, and heat the mixture up.  

When the soup is nice and hot, place it in bowls, and pour (or squeeze) some of that lemon juice in.
